I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JDBC Java Discussion :

Quel SGBD utiliser ?


Sujet :

JDBC Java

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éclairé
    Inscrit en
    Octobre 2005
    Messages
    259
    Détails du profil
    Informations personnelles :
    Âge : 42

    Informations forums :
    Inscription : Octobre 2005
    Messages : 259
    Par défaut Quel SGBD utiliser ?
    Bonjour,

    J'aimerais réaliser une application permettant de gérer les membres d'un club.

    J'aimerais savoir ce qu'il est conseillé d'utiliser: MySQL ou Access ou autre ...
    Car ne sais pas depuis JAVA si il est mieux d'utiliser MySQL plutot que Access ou encore autre chose.

    Personnellement, j'aimerais utiliser MySQL mais je ne sais pas quels outils utiliser pour créer et gérer ma base de données.
    J'ai entendu parler de MySQL Administrator et MySQL Query Browser.


    Merci d'avance

  2. #2
    Rédacteur
    Avatar de CyberChouan
    Homme Profil pro
    Directeur technique
    Inscrit en
    Janvier 2007
    Messages
    2 752
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Directeur technique
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Janvier 2007
    Messages : 2 752
    Par défaut
    En java, tu peux coder ton application en restant quasiment indépendant du SGBD utilisé (la connexion passe par jdbc et seul le driver de connexion à ta base change d'un SGBD à un autre) => cf. les tutoriaux

    En ce qui concerne le SGBD, je te conseille plutôt PostgreSQL que MySQL comme SGBD gratuit. Il permet de développer ses bases de données de manière plus propre (avec des clés étrangères et des séquences, avec une syntaxe proche de celle d'Oracle)
    Avant de poster, pensez à regarder la FAQ, les tutoriaux, la Javadoc (de la JRE que vous utilisez) et à faire une recherche
    Je ne réponds pas aux questions techniques par MP: les forums sont faits pour ça
    Mes articles et tutoriaux & Mon blog informatique

  3. #3
    Expert confirmé
    Avatar de le y@m's
    Homme Profil pro
    Ingénieur développement logiciels
    Inscrit en
    Février 2005
    Messages
    2 636
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Alpes Maritimes (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Ingénieur développement logiciels
    Secteur : High Tech - Produits et services télécom et Internet

    Informations forums :
    Inscription : Février 2005
    Messages : 2 636
    Par défaut
    Regarde aussi du coté des BD embarquées telles que Derby (JavaDB) et HSQLDB.
    Je ne répondrai à aucune question technique par MP.

    Pensez aux Tutoriels et aux FAQs avant de poster ;) (pour le java il y a aussi JavaSearch), n'oubliez pas non plus la fonction Rechercher.
    Enfin, quand une solution a été trouvée à votre problème
    pensez au tag :resolu:

    Cours Dvp : http://ydisanto.developpez.com
    Blog : http://yann-disanto.blogspot.com/
    Page perso : http://yann-disanto.fr

  4. #4
    Membre Expert Avatar de willoi
    Profil pro
    Développeur informatique
    Inscrit en
    Décembre 2006
    Messages
    1 355
    Détails du profil
    Informations personnelles :
    Âge : 52
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Décembre 2006
    Messages : 1 355
    Par défaut
    Je pense que mysql est plus stable et moins lourd que Access, et pratique un sql plus standard aussi.

    Pour la gestion, il existe mysql navigator qui est pas mal bien que peu convivial.
    Tu peux installer un plug-in dans Eclipse type Dbedit aussi.

    Sinon regarde aussi comme SGBD du cote de postgreSQL qui je crois possede un editeur de bdd sympa.

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Avril 2005
    Messages
    19
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France

    Informations forums :
    Inscription : Avril 2005
    Messages : 19
    Par défaut
    je conseille egalement postgreSQL bien meilleur que MySQL a mon avis surtout si tu compte utilise des triggers ou procedures stockees. postgre fournit egalement un langage procedural nommé PgPL/SQL.
    Sinon oracle fournit egalement une version gratuite de son SGBD nommé oracleXE. Très performant, il permet de stoquer jusqu'à 2 Go de donnee je crois, il y a de la marge.

  6. #6
    Membre expérimenté Avatar de Roy Miro
    Profil pro
    Inscrit en
    Avril 2007
    Messages
    273
    Détails du profil
    Informations personnelles :
    Âge : 39
    Localisation : France

    Informations forums :
    Inscription : Avril 2007
    Messages : 273
    Par défaut
    A noter que MySQLAdministrator ne te permet pas de créer une base de données. Cet outil (très bon au passage) te permet de faire des sauvegardes ou des restaurations de ta BD. Tu peux par contre créer des utilisateurs et gérer leurs droits sur telle ou telle BD. Tu peux interdire à un utilisateur donné de supprimer/modifier des champs.

    En java, tu peux coder ton application en restant quasiment indépendant du SGBD utilisé (la connexion passe par jdbc et seul le driver de connexion à ta base change d'un SGBD à un autre) => cf. les tutoriaux
    En fait, pour java les requetes SQL ne sont que des chaînes de caractères, les erreurs de syntaxe ne seront détectées qu'à l'éxécution.

  7. #7
    Membre éclairé
    Inscrit en
    Octobre 2005
    Messages
    259
    Détails du profil
    Informations personnelles :
    Âge : 42

    Informations forums :
    Inscription : Octobre 2005
    Messages : 259
    Par défaut
    Merci pour ces précieuses indications.

    Je pense que je vais me pencher vers PostGreSQL ou sur une BD embarquée que je ne connaissais pas du tout.

    Encore merci à tous

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Quel SGBD dois-je utiliser?
    Par tastastoussa dans le forum Décisions SGBD
    Réponses: 2
    Dernier message: 26/03/2014, 18h37
  2. quel sgbd utiliser :)
    Par vinou94400 dans le forum JDBC
    Réponses: 2
    Dernier message: 15/05/2010, 16h07
  3. [A-03] Quel SGBD utilise vraiment Access ?
    Par MaxLaMenaX dans le forum Access
    Réponses: 3
    Dernier message: 02/12/2008, 14h49
  4. Quel SGBD utiliser??
    Par 78alex78 dans le forum Bases de données
    Réponses: 3
    Dernier message: 25/04/2005, 18h28
  5. Quels SGBD sont gratuits pour une utilisation commerciale ?
    Par laffreuxthomas dans le forum Décisions SGBD
    Réponses: 28
    Dernier message: 15/03/2005, 16h51

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o